在数字化时代,网站安全是每个网站运营者都需要关注的重要问题。网站安全漏洞如果不及时修复,可能会被恶意攻击者利用,导致数据泄露、网站瘫痪甚至经济损失。本文将详细介绍一种有效的网站安全漏洞修复方法,帮助您提高网站的安全性。
一、了解网站安全漏洞
首先,我们需要了解什么是网站安全漏洞。网站安全漏洞是指网站中存在的可以被攻击者利用的缺陷,如SQL注入、XSS攻击、CSRF攻击等。这些漏洞可能会导致以下后果:
- 数据泄露:攻击者可以获取网站用户的敏感信息,如用户名、密码、信用卡信息等。
- 网站瘫痪:攻击者可以控制网站,导致网站无法正常访问。
- 经济损失:攻击者可能通过网站进行非法活动,给网站运营者带来经济损失。
二、网站安全漏洞修复方法
1. 定期进行安全扫描
安全扫描是发现网站漏洞的重要手段。您可以使用以下工具进行安全扫描:
- OWASP ZAP
- Burp Suite
- Acunetix
通过安全扫描,您可以发现网站中的潜在漏洞,并及时修复。
2. 修复已知漏洞
在发现漏洞后,您需要根据漏洞的严重程度进行修复。以下是一些常见的漏洞修复方法:
SQL注入
- 使用参数化查询,避免将用户输入直接拼接到SQL语句中。
- 对用户输入进行过滤和验证,确保输入数据符合预期格式。
XSS攻击
- 对用户输入进行编码,防止浏览器将其作为HTML标签执行。
- 使用内容安全策略(CSP)限制可信任的脚本来源。
CSRF攻击
- 使用令牌验证机制,确保用户请求的合法性。
- 限制跨站请求的来源,只允许来自同一域名或信任域名的请求。
3. 加强网站安全配置
以下是一些加强网站安全配置的方法:
- 限制登录尝试次数,防止暴力破解。
- 设置强密码策略,要求用户使用复杂密码。
- 关闭不必要的功能和服务,减少攻击面。
4. 使用HTTPS协议
HTTPS协议可以加密网站数据传输,防止数据被窃取。您可以通过以下方法启用HTTPS:
- 购买SSL证书。
- 将网站配置为使用HTTPS。
三、总结
网站安全漏洞修复是一个持续的过程,需要我们不断关注新出现的漏洞和攻击手段。通过以上方法,您可以提高网站的安全性,降低被攻击的风险。希望本文能帮助您更好地保护您的网站。
